Radiation-induced dechlorination of hexachlorobenzene

A study on radiation-induced dechlorination of hexachlorobenzene in alkaline ethanol solution was performed. At the beginning a higher efficiency for dechlorination has been found. The dechlorination is a chain reaction. The solubility of radiolytic products in ethanol-water (v/v 1:4) is higher than that of HCB in the same solvent. Hexachlorobenzene could be transferred into the solution and degraded partially if the soil contaminated by hexachlorobenzene was mixed with ethanol, then irradiated with γ-rays. (author)
